Black Letter

Jests Home






AN old friend of Charles Lamb having been in vain trying to make out a
black-letter text of Chaucer in the Temple Library, laid down the
precious volume, and with an erudite look told Lamb that in those old
books, Charley, there is sometimes a deal of very indifferent
spelling.
